Assessing the Problem of Your Siding
When house owners choose to carry out siding repair tasks, examining the condition of their siding is an essential very first step. This evaluation entails a comprehensive evaluation of the exterior surface areas, searching for indications of damages such as splits, warping, or mold growth. Homeowners must likewise look for loose or absent panels, as these problems can endanger the honesty of the siding and lead to additional problems, such as water seepage. Furthermore, inspecting the joints and joints is crucial, as these areas are frequently prone to deterioration. An aesthetic examination may be supplemented by touching the siding to identify hollow audios, indicating potential underlying damages. Keeping in mind of any discoloration or peeling paint can also give understandings into dampness problems. Documenting these searchings for assists property owners make informed decisions around required repair services or substitutes, setting a solid foundation for their siding repair tasks.

Product Resilience Factors To Consider
Picking the proper products for siding repair is crucial, as the longevity and performance of the repair mostly depend upon material toughness. Homeowners ought to consider variables such as weather condition resistance, upkeep needs, and general life expectancy when selecting materials. Alternatives like vinyl, fiber cement, and wood each deal distinctive advantages; as an example, plastic is resistant to fading and moisture, while fiber cement is recognized for its extraordinary toughness versus harsh problems (siding repair greenville nc). It is also vital to account for regional climate affects, as products might do differently based upon regional environmental elements. By prioritizing resilient materials, house owners can guarantee that their siding repair services endure the test of time, inevitably lowering the demand for future repairs and improving the home's general worth

Gathering Necessary Tools and Tools
A comprehensive toolset is essential for any type of siding repair task, ensuring that the job can be completed successfully and properly. A homeowner or contractor should start by collecting basic devices such as a hammer, energy knife, and level. These things are essential for eliminating damaged siding and guaranteeing proper positioning throughout installment. Furthermore, a lever can assist in the careful elimination of old panels without creating further damage.
Security equipment, including handwear covers and goggles, is additionally vital to secure versus sharp sides and debris. Depending upon the kind of siding, specific devices like a nail gun or caulking gun may be necessary for attaching and sealing. A measuring tape will assure accurate cuts and fitting of new pieces. Having a ladder on hand is vital for getting to top locations safely. Accumulating these tools beforehand will certainly simplify the repair process and assistance accomplish a professional surface.

Adhere To Installment Standards
Thoroughly adhering to installation guidelines is crucial for attaining a successful siding repair. These guidelines, frequently supplied by the maker, overview particular procedures and methods essential for excellent results. Following these directions assurances that the products are installed correctly, lowering the likelihood of future problems such as bending, leakages, or pest seepage. Appropriate sequencing is also important; beginning with the base and functioning upwards enables efficient drainage and avoids wetness accumulation. Additionally, making use of advised tools and fasteners assurances structural honesty and enhances the longevity of the repair. By faithfully following these installation guidelines, property owners can guarantee that their siding fixings not just satisfy visual requirements however additionally keep the safety feature of the outside of their homes.
Inspecting the Finished Work
A detailed evaluation of the ended up siding repair is vital for making certain high quality and durability. As soon as the task is total, an in-depth evaluation should be conducted to recognize any type of issues or locations calling for further interest. This evaluation ought to cover alignment, making certain that all panels are straight and evenly spaced. The stability of seams and joints should likewise be inspected for gaps or misalignments that could lead to moisture intrusion.
Furthermore, examining for proper fastening and securing of the siding is important, as loose panels can compromise the overall structure. The aesthetic element should not be neglected; the shade and surface need to be uniform and match the bordering areas. Any kind of issues discovered during the inspection ought to be addressed promptly to stop future difficulties. Eventually, a thorough evaluation of the completed job not just confirms the workmanship however additionally establishes the structure for the long life of the siding repair.
Keeping Your Siding for Longevity
While numerous you can find out more home owners may overlook routine maintenance, maintaining siding is vital for its long life and efficiency. Normal assessments can determine issues such as splits, peeling off, or mold and mildew development before they rise into pricey repair services. Cleaning up siding at the very least two times a year assists remove dirt, crud, and mold, avoiding degeneration. Property owners must make use of a mild cleaning option and a soft brush or towel to prevent damaging the product.
In addition, assuring correct drainage around the home is necessary. Stopped up rain gutters can result in water damage, endangering the siding's honesty. Using safety layers, when ideal, can additionally expand its life expectancy.

What Are Usual Indicators of Siding Damages?
Common indications of siding damages consist of fractures, warping, peeling paint, mold and mildew growth, and loose panels. House owners should routinely check their siding to recognize these problems early and prevent more deterioration or water intrusion.
Just How Lengthy Does Siding Repair Typically Take?
The duration of siding repair differs substantially based upon damages level and project extent. Commonly, minor repair services can take a few hours, while comprehensive substitutes might call for numerous days, relying on weather and team schedule.
Do I Need Authorizations for Siding Repair?
The requirement for authorizations during siding repair varies by location. Usually, regional laws determine whether authorizations are required, so it is suggested for property owners to talk to regional authorities prior to commencing any type of repair tasks.
